How Life Works Here
Lily Crescent is located in Newcastle upon Tyne. Crime is around average for the area, with 172 incidents in the past year. The most commonly reported category is anti-social behaviour. Some amenities are available nearby, though a car may be useful for regular errands like grocery shopping. Transport connections are strong, with rail and bus links nearby. The nearest stop (Osborne Road - Holly Avenue) is 117m away. The median property price is £491,500. Based on 13 transactions recorded since 2014. The local area has a moderate population, with a high proportion of rented accommodation, with larger households suggesting families. There are 3 schools within 2 km, 3 rated Good or Outstanding by Ofsted. Primary schools are nearby, though secondary options may require travel. The nearest school is just 283m away. The profile suggests appeal to both young professionals and families. Market indicators suggest an upward trend. Overall, this street scores 57 out of 100 for liveability, placing it in the top 16% within its district.
